找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 112|回复: 10

[已解决] 轻轻的我来了 请教大家个问题

[复制链接]

20

主题

179

回帖

426

积分

中级会员

积分
426
发表于 2015-2-27 07:37:47 | 显示全部楼层 |阅读模式
本帖最后由 dscang 于 2015-3-1 15:50 编辑

关注论坛很长时间了,一直苦于论坛不开放注册,感觉论坛的氛围还是蛮不错的。下面进入正题,请教一个关于amh反代的问题,感谢各位!


我有一个站,想通过反代来达到隐藏源站ip的目的,只看到本论坛有简单的反代教程,搞了半天也没成功,后来知道amh有反代模块,但是在愚钝不会设置,弄了半天也没有成功。想请教大家应该如何设置啊?

比如,我的源站A(www.123.com,IP 100.100.100.100 吧)放在linode,amh的反代模块B(IP 123.123.123.123 )放在vultr,域名解析应该解析到B的吧?我上图,请大家看看对不对。




本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

×
回复

使用道具 举报

20

主题

179

回帖

426

积分

中级会员

积分
426
 楼主| 发表于 2015-3-3 13:06:29 | 显示全部楼层

qqcm 发表于 2015-3-3 11:44

源网站用的是带http://的绝对连接的原因,这种就需要用关键字替换功能把域名替换为你的域名。同样这个功 ...

原来是这个样子,感谢你的热心啊!
顺便请教下你一个别的问题,这个问题我求助了好几个论坛都没能够解决。把希望寄托在你身上了。哈哈!

http://www.hostloc.com/thread-269414-1-1.html

网上有教程修改代码,但是我尝试过均以失败告终。我不清楚插入到那个位置。不吝赐教!
回复

使用道具 举报

73

主题

1480

回帖

3219

积分

论坛元老

积分
3219
发表于 2015-3-3 11:44:00 | 显示全部楼层

dscang 发表于 2015-3-3 11:13

@qqcm

默认反代的是全站,如果不是那就是别人网站做了防反代除了,需要设置ua等来解决,这些需要直接修 ...

源网站用的是带http://的绝对连接的原因,这种就需要用关键字替换功能把域名替换为你的域名。同样这个功能需要重新编译nginx,对初学者难度较大。amh可能没有这个功能,有的话你设置即可!
回复

使用道具 举报

20

主题

179

回帖

426

积分

中级会员

积分
426
 楼主| 发表于 2015-3-3 11:44:26 | 显示全部楼层

qqcm 发表于 2015-2-27 08:59

host定义、referer请填写域名!

@qqcm

默认反代的是全站,如果不是那就是别人网站做了防反代除了,需要设置ua等来解决,这些需要直接修改nginx配置文件的

我用a域名反代b域名,结果打开a网址,是b的页面,但页面内连接还是a的,是哪里设置不对吗?
回复

使用道具 举报

34

主题

480

回帖

1070

积分

金牌会员

积分
1070
发表于 2015-3-3 11:13:00 | 显示全部楼层


回复

使用道具 举报

20

主题

179

回帖

426

积分

中级会员

积分
426
 楼主| 发表于 2015-3-3 11:13:04 | 显示全部楼层

qqcm 发表于 2015-3-1 13:57

注意:www.co.cc直接绑定1.1.1.1能访问才行!1.1.1.1是你放网站的服务器ip,不是反代服务器ip!
...

兄弟谢谢了,你弄得图很详细,现在已经反代成功!
如果反代别人网站,只能反代首页吗?
回复

使用道具 举报

73

主题

1480

回帖

3219

积分

论坛元老

积分
3219
发表于 2015-2-27 08:59:00 | 显示全部楼层
本帖最后由 qqcm 于 2015-3-1 14:00 编辑

注意:www.co.cc直接绑定1.1.1.1能访问才行!1.1.1.1是你放网站的服务器ip,不是反代服务器ip!


本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

×
回复

使用道具 举报

20

主题

179

回帖

426

积分

中级会员

积分
426
 楼主| 发表于 2015-3-1 20:24:45 | 显示全部楼层
本帖最后由 dscang 于 2015-2-28 16:22 编辑

qqcm 发表于 2015-2-28 08:44

1.原始站点直接绑定你的域名后能正常访问。假如你的域名为:cc.cc 源站ip:1.1.1.1 那么这个域名绑定你源 ...


兄弟按照你说的,我搞了,但是出来的是400 网关请求超时错误。如果反代服务器ip是2.2.2.2,域名是解析到2.2.2.2是不?

截图如下,你看下对吗?



回复

使用道具 举报

73

主题

1480

回帖

3219

积分

论坛元老

积分
3219
发表于 2015-3-1 15:48:54 | 显示全部楼层

dscang 发表于 2015-2-27 23:15

我就一个域名。。是填写主域名吗?
反代至少需要2个不同域名,或者至少一个域名或一个二级域名吧? ...

1.原始站点直接绑定你的域名后能正常访问。假如你的域名为:cc.cc 源站ip:1.1.1.1 那么这个域名绑定你源站ip,1.1.1.1后能直接访问到网站页面!

2.解绑源站域名并重新解析到反代站,反代域名填写源站ip,http://1.1.1.1.referer定义填写:http://cc.cc
host定义填写:cc.cc (不加http://)
回复

使用道具 举报

0

主题

1

回帖

4

积分

新手上路

积分
4
发表于 2015-3-1 13:57:00 | 显示全部楼层

qqcm 发表于 2015-2-27 08:59

host定义、referer请填写域名!

我就一个域名。。是填写主域名吗?
反代至少需要2个不同域名,或者至少一个域名或一个二级域名吧?host定义、referer请填写域名!
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|Discuz! X

GMT+8, 2025-2-1 06:46 , Processed in 0.023770 second(s), 3 queries , Gzip On, Redis On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表